Types Of Packing Tape

Packing tapes are a crucial component in the packaging industry. They are used to seal boxes, bind merchandise, and secure items for transportation. Different types of packing tapes are available in the market, each serving a specific purpose.

Acrylic Packing Tape

Acrylic packing tape is a general-purpose tape that works well for light to medium-duty applications. Here are the key details you should know about acrylic packing tape.

  • Made of pressure-sensitive adhesive, acrylic packing tape is long-lasting and stable.
  • It is ideal for sealing boxes for shipping, storage, and general-purpose applications.
  • Acrylic tape is resistant to ageing, sunlight, and uv light.
  • You can use acrylic tape in various temperatures, and it handles extreme temperature fluctuations well.
  • Acrylic tape is readily available and cost-effective.

Hot-Melt Packing Tape

Also known as synthetic rubber packing tape, hot-melt packing tape is the ideal choice for heavy-duty applications. Here are the key details you should know about hot-melt packing tape.

  • Hot-melt packing tape is made from synthetic rubber. It offers good adhesion, flexibility, and high shear strength.
  • It can handle extreme temperatures, making it suitable for outdoor applications.
  • Hot-melt tape is suitable for packaging corrugated boxes, cartons, and heavy-duty sealing.
  • It is affordable and readily available.

Paper Packing Tape

Paper packing tape is less known, but it is a good replacement for people who are looking for eco-friendly packing tape. It is becoming more popular lately. Here are the key details you should know about paper packing tape.

  • It is eco-friendly, biodegradable, and made of kraft paper.
  • It is ideal for sealing boxes, cartons, and envelopes.
  • Paper tape is water-activated, so it provides a stronger bond than acrylic tape.
  • It has low noise when unrolling, making it an excellent option for quiet working environments.
  • It is affordable and easy to obtain.

Other Specialty Packing Tapes

Apart from the three primary types of tapes, there are also some specialty packing tapes available in the market.

  • Double-sided tape, ideal for point-of-sale packaging, holding retail displays and signs.
  • Filament tape, reinforced with fiberglass, ideal for securing heavy items like metal pipes and lumber bundles.
  • Masking tape, suitable for painting applications or bundling boxes.
  • Printed packing tape, customizable with your company logo or message, so it can also serve as a marketing tool.

Type Of Surface Being Taped

The type of surface you’re planning to tape is crucial when choosing the right packing tape. Some surfaces are more delicate, requiring a gentler tape, and others are tougher with more friction, making it necessary to consider the durability of the tape.

If you’re dealing with a fragile item, consider using a tape with a gentle adhesive or a masking tape. If you’re sealing a box, corrugated cardboard is ideal, and it will require a tape that offers excellent adhesion. Check the specifications of the tape you’re interested in selecting to determine whether it’s ideal for your intended surface.

Temperature And Environment

Temperature and environmental factors can significantly impact your choice of packing tape. If you’re moving items in an area with high humidity, make sure you select tape with a strong adhesive. Choosing a tape that responds well in hot or cold temperatures, such as acrylic tapes, is important when dealing with extreme weather conditions.

Some tapes can become brittle or get too gooey when exposed to temperature changes, making them unsuitable. So, before making your tape selection, consider the temperature and environment in which the item will be packing and shipped.

Weight Of Package

The weight of a package is an important factor to consider when choosing packing tape. For heavier shipments, a tape that is sturdy and durable is crucial. A tape with a wider thickness (indicated on the packaging as mils) is ideal for added strength.

For smaller or lighter parcels, a tape with a thinner width can work. Nevertheless, bear in mind that the tape must still provide enough adhesive strength to hold the package securely.

Storage And Handling

Before we dive into the application techniques, it’s essential to cover the proper storage and handling of your packing tape.

  • Store your packing tape in a cool and dry place to prevent heat and moisture damage.
  • Use the tape within its shelf life period, which is usually mentioned on the tape dispenser or packaging.
  • Make sure you’re handling the tape carefully as it can get tangled or rip easily, leading to wastage.

Proper Application Techniques

When it comes to packing tape, application technique is critical. No one wants to move their belongings only to find out they didn’t stick together during transit.

  • Use a dispenser to avoid tangling the tape and for better control while applying it.
  • Start by applying the tape in the center of the box or item, then proceed with the sides and edges with an overlapping technique of 2-3 inches.
  • Use enough pressure while applying the tape to ensure it holds firmly, but don’t overdo it to avoid damaging the package.

How To Avoid Common Problems

When it comes to packing tape, some common problems can arise if you don’t follow the best practices.

  • Don’t use one long piece of tape to cover the entire box’s width. The tape will eventually stretch with time, leading to an inadequate hold on the package.
  • Avoid using low-quality tapes as they could unravel and compromise the security of your items.
  • If you make a mistake while applying the tape, it’s always better to start again with new tape than to try to fix it with additional layers.

Frequently Asked Questions Of Packing Tape

What Types Of Packing Tape Are Available?

There are a variety of packing tapes available to choose from, including clear, colored, printed, heavy-duty, and masking tape. Determine your specific needs before selecting the right type of tape for your packaging requirements.

Can Packing Tape Be Used To Ship Heavy Items?

Yes, heavy-duty packing tape is specifically designed for shipping heavy items. It has a strong backing and adhesive that can handle bulky and heavy packages, ensuring they stay secure and protected during transport.

Is It Better To Use Packing Tape Or Duct Tape For Packing?

Packing tape is a better option for packing than duct tape. Packing tape is more durable, has stronger adhesive properties, and is specifically designed for packaging applications, whereas duct tape may not hold as well and can leave sticky residue.

Can Packing Tape Be Used In Extreme Temperatures?

Yes, most packing tapes are designed to withstand varying temperatures. However, ensure to select tapes that are suitable for use in freezing or hot temperatures, depending on your packaging needs.

How Should Packing Tape Be Stored?

Packing tape should be stored in a cool and dry place, away from direct sunlight. Avoid exposing the tape to extreme temperatures or moisture, which may diminish the adhesive’s strength. Always store the tape on its end to prevent it from being flattened.
